    Amazon.com
    Sure, Johnny Cash is a country superstar and a founding father of rock & roll--but why, exactly? Johnny Cash: The Anthology is an efficient and highly enjoyable effort to answer that question through a rare historical perspective. Comprised of a 54-minute documentary and a supplementary film entitled Half Mile a Day, The Anthology places Cash dead center at the junction of gospel and blues traditions: between the isolation of hard living in America, delusional guilt from too much sin, and the fragile redemption of love. Drawing upon archival footage of Cash performing his earliest crossover hits ("Five Feet High and Risin'," "I Walk the Line") and including comments by admiring peers (Rodney Crowell, Porter Wagoner), The Anthology makes a compelling case for Cash as a master of knife-edged economy and a populist oracle from a younger, perhaps scarier, America. If it has become too easy over the decades to take Cash for granted, The Anthology sets things straight. --Tom Keogh

    3 out of 5 stars Too much talk, not enough music   November 19, 2005
    Steven Hellerstedt
    18 out of 22 found this review helpful

    Five stars if this is a referendum on Johnny Cash, three stars for this premium-priced dvd.

    The songs are good - Cash was a great entertainer, and the chance to see him through almost fifty years of performances is welcome. The `Half Mile a Day' documentary is informative and somewhat adoring, with a number of performers and record-industry folk attesting to Cash's greatness. It gives you a sense of the man behind the music. A peek rather than a critical examination, but satisfying enough.

    Still, `The Anthology' pretty much repeats everything in `Half Mile a Day.' The songs are presented complete in Anthology, chopped up in Half Mile. Some of the talking head comments appear in both programs, as well.

    Half Mile includes a bit of Cash singing `Turn! Turn! Turn!' with Judy Collins, which kind of indicates the dvd producers had access and rights to Cash's old television program. As a fan with extended demands for premium priced dvds, I'd have appreciated maybe another dozen songs - from the television show, or somewhere - and that much less talking heads.
